How to Convert Foot/second to Mile/minute

1 ft/s = 0.0113636363636364 mi/min

Example: convert 15 ft/s to mi/min:
15 ft/s = 15 × 0.0113636363636364 mi/min = 0.170454545454545 mi/min

Foot/second

Foot per second (ft/s) is a unit of speed representing the distance of one foot traveled in one second.

History/Origin

The foot per second has been used historically in engineering, physics, and aeronautics, originating from the imperial measurement system where the foot is a standard unit of length. Its usage predates the metric system and has been common in the United States and other countries using imperial units.

Current Use

Today, ft/s is primarily used in fields such as physics, engineering, and aviation to measure speeds, especially in contexts where imperial units are standard. It is also used in sports and safety standards related to speed measurements.


Mile/minute

A unit of speed representing the number of miles traveled per minute.

History/Origin

The mile per minute has been used historically in contexts such as aviation and transportation to measure rapid speeds before the widespread adoption of metric units and modern speed measurements like miles per hour or meters per second.

Current Use

Currently, mile per minute is rarely used in everyday contexts but may appear in specialized fields such as aviation, military, or scientific calculations where high-speed measurements are relevant.
